WHEN AI GOES ROGUE: Jailbroken LLMs, Autonomous Agents, and the New Cyber Threat
What you will learn:
What happens when an LLM stops refusing—and starts acting? This session explores how jailbroken and rogue LLMs, combined with autonomous agents and access to real tools, can transform prompt manipulation into real-world cyber risk. We examine recent incidents, the emerging agentic attack surface, and demonstrate how Imperum Agent Studio can simulate these threats while Virtus Sentinel detects rogue LLMs, prompt injection, jailbreak attempts, and malicious agent behavior—turning the attacker’s AI advantage into a powerful tool for continuously testing and hardening cyber defenses.
